What's Happening?
Taylor Townsend has reached the fourth round of the US Open after defeating world No. 5 Mirra Andreeva. Townsend's victory comes after a controversial exchange with Jelena Ostapenko, who criticized Townsend's sportsmanship. Despite the tension, Townsend focused on her performance, showcasing her skills and determination. Her win against Andreeva marks a significant achievement, equaling her best performance at a Grand Slam singles tournament.

What's Next?
Taylor Townsend will face Barbora Krejčíková in the fourth round of the US Open. This match presents another opportunity for Townsend to demonstrate her capabilities and potentially advance further in the tournament.
